您可以使用命令,在MySQL和Oracle数据库中查看列信息或任何表的结构,而在SQL Server中,可以使用实际的表名替换table_name。DESCRIBE table_name;EXEC sp_columns table_name; 步骤2:将记录添加到表 以下语句在persons表中插入新行。 示例 INSERT INTO persons (name, birth_date, phone) VALUES ('Peter Wilson',...
OracleSQLinsertinto语句总结与mergeinto用法总结 在Oracle SQL中,INSERT INTO语句用于向表中插入新的行。 INSERTINTO语法如下: ``` INSERT INTO table_name (column1, column2, column3, ...) VALUES (value1, value2, value3, ...); ``` 其中,table_name是要插入数据的表名,column1, column2, column...
注:Oracle的标识列自增非常执着,如匿名存储过程执行一半出错,但是执行了insert into语句,或者执行单个的insert into语句,再rollback,标识列都会更新。 declareidxnumber;begininsertintoDishes(DishName,UnitPrice,CategoryId)values('西红柿',10,2);selectseq_dishes.currvalintoidxfromdual; dbms_output.put_line(idx)...
oracle中insert into用法 INSERT INTO是oracle中最常用的SQL命令之一,用于向数据表中插入一行数据或多行数据。它的使用格式为:INSERT INTO <表名> (列1, 列2, ….) VALUES(值1, 值2, ….) INSERT INTO语句的主要关键字有表名和VALUES.表名是指要在其中插入记录的数据表,而VALUES子句中的括号内的值可以是...
1)SQL> create table a (id int,name char(10) default 'aaa'); //name列指定了default值 2)SQL> insert into a values(1,'abc'); //表a后没有所选列,values必须指定所有字段的值。 3)SQL> insert into a values(2,default); //同上,name字段用default占位。
Oracle对表数据的插入是使用insert命令来执行的。 insert 命令结构: insertinto表名(列名1,列名2,列名3...)values(值1,值2,值3...); 语法解析: 1、列名可以省略,当列名不填时,默认的是表中的所有列,列的顺序是按照建表的顺序进行排列的。 2、列名...
> ### 摘要 > 在 Oracle 11g SQL 中,`INSERT INTO` 语句是用于向数据库表中添加数据的关键操作。它支持单行插入、批量插入和基于查询结果的插入三种主要方式。批量插入通常借助 PL/SQL 块或外部工具(如 SQL*Loader)实现。插入时需确保列顺序与值顺序一致,并注意数据类型匹配问题。通过子查询可将查询结果直接插入...
1. 使用批量插入:如果需要插入大量数据,可以使用INSERT INTO...SELECT语句一次性插入多行数据,而不是一行一行插入,可以减少插入操作的开销。2. 使用并行插入:可以使用并行插入来...
在Oracle数据库中,INSERT INTO语句用于向表中插入新的数据行。通过该语句,你可以指定要插入数据的列以及相应的值。 语法 基本语法 INSERT INTO table_name (column1, column2, column3, ...) VALUES (value1, value2, value3, ...); table_name:目标表的名称。 column1, column2, column3, ...:要...
oracle insert into语句 Oracle是一种强大的关系数据库管理系统。当我们需要插入数据时,可以使用INSERT INTO语句。这条语句可以将一条记录插入到表中。 INSERT INTO语句中必须指定表名,并且必须提供一组需要插入的值。如果您在表中定义了列,则可以选择性地指定列。例如: ```sql INSERT INTO users (first_name, ...